Pequeño script para crear matrices e imprimir varios de sus valores.
#include <iostream>
using namespace std;
int main() {
int numeros[999][999];
int filas, columnas;
int i, j;
int x;
// Definición de la Matriz
cout << "Porfavor especifique el numero de lineas deseadas: ";
cin >> filas;
cout << endl << "Porfavor especifique el numero de columnas deseadas: ";
cin >> columnas;
cout << endl;
// Valores de la Matriz
for (i = 0; i < filas; i++) {
for (j = 0; j < columnas; j++) {
cout << "Introduzca el valor de [" << i << "][" << j << "]: ";
cin >> numeros[i][j];
cout << endl;
}
}
// Diagonal principal de la matriz
cout << "Diagonal Principal: ";
for (i = 0, j = 0; i < filas; i++, j++) {
cout << numeros[i][j];
if (i + 1 < filas) {
cout << ", ";
}
}
cout << endl;
// Valores bajo la diagonal principal
cout << "Valores debajo de la diagonal principal: ";
for (i = 0, j = 0; i < filas; i++, j++) {
for (x = 0; x < j; x++) {
cout << numeros[i][x];
if (i + 1 < filas || x + 1 < j) {
cout << ", ";
}
}
}
cout << endl;
// Diagonal Inversa
cout << "Diagonal Inversa: ";
for (i = 0, j = columnas - 1; i < filas; i++, j--) {
cout << numeros[i][j];
if (i + 1 < filas) {
cout << ", ";
}
}
cout << endl;
// Valores bajo la diagonal inversq
cout << "Valores debajo de la diagonal inversa: ";
for (i = 0, j = columnas - 1; i < filas; i++, j--) {
for (x = j + 1; x < columnas; x++) {
cout << numeros[i][x];
if (i + 1 < filas || x + 1 < columnas) {
cout << ", ";
}
}
}
}
